How to write a migrate to undo the unique constraint in Laravel?

You have to do $table->dropUnique('users_email_unique');

To drop an index you must specify the index’s name. Laravel assigns a
reasonable name to the indexes by default. Simply concatenate the
table name, the names of the column in the index, and the index type.
